Aggravated Assault
On 10/09/07, at 9:52 p. m., police responded to the 800 block of Quince Orchard Boulevard for a report of a shooting. Upon arrival, the victim advised officers that he was in front of his residence when an unknown suspect walked up to him and words were exchanged. The victim stated that the suspect then pointed a black handgun at his head, he (victim) knocked it away, and it went off. The victim stated that the suspect then ran away.
Suspect - Black male, 20-25 yrs old, 5′6″- 5′8″, 180 lbs., wearing a black shirt with a red design on the front.
Burglary
Sometime between 1:00 a.m. and 7:30 a.m. on 10/10/07, a residence in the 200 block of Midsummer Drive was entered through an unlocked side garage door. Property was taken from inside the residence.
Sometime between 5:00 a.m. and 7:30 a.m. on 10/10/07, the attached garage of a residence in the 500 block of Whetstone Glen Street was entered and property was taken.
Sometime between 12:00 a.m. and 2:00 a.m. on 10/10/07, a residence in the 600 block of Pelican Avenue was burglarized. The suspect entered an unlocked vehicle and obtained the garage door opener to gain access to the residence. Property was taken from the vehicle. Unknown at this time if anything was taken from the residence.
Midsummer Drive is near Muddy Branch & Darnestown Road (MD28). Whetstone Glen Street and Pelican Avenue are in Hidden Creek, the new development at the end of Odend’Hal Ave.
